Gainey Inherits All-Tech Win for CRUSA Late Model Sportsman Tour Opener

(Lake City, FL – March 1, 2025) – Wyatt Gainey, hailing from Ft. White, FL, captured his first career victory in the Rogers-Dabbs Performance Parts Crate Racin' USA Late Model Sportsman Tour at All-Tech Raceway, following a dramatic twist in the opening race of the 2025 season. Gainey inherited the win after post-race inspection revealed an issue with the left rear spring of the car driven by Jason Garver, who had crossed the finish line first.

The race, which marked the official start of the second season for the CRUSA 602 Late Model Sportsman Tour, was a thrilling 25-lap feature filled with drama. Gainey, who had started the race from third after winning his heat race, was in position to capitalize as the race unfolded. Early leader Bubba Roling of Clay Hill, FL, dominated the first part of the race, holding the top spot through multiple caution periods. However, just three laps from the finish, Roling was forced to retire from the race with an electrical issue, handing the lead over to Garver, who held it until the checkered flag.

Despite Garver's strong performance, a post-race technical inspection led to his disqualification, elevating Gainey to the top of the podium. Brayden Johnson of Moultrie, GA, finished second, while Caleb Ashby from Cunningham, TN, rounded out the podium in third.

The series now shifts its focus to the 2nd Annual Southern Heritage Classic at Needmore Speedway in Norman Park, GA, March 27-29. The event will feature a $4,000-to-win feature and will include both preliminary events on Friday and the main event on Saturday night. March 1 - All-Tech Raceway Results: (25 laps)
1-8 Wyatt Gainey-Ft White, FL
2-175 Brayden Johnson-Moultrie, GA
3-61 Caleb Ashby-Cunningham, TN
4-111 Brennen Shirley-Rainbow City, AL
5-611 Koulten Herbert-Locust Grove, GA
6-14S Brian Scott-Lake City, FL
7-10 Mario Gresham-Rome, GA
8-17SR Brody Smith-Dade City, FL
9-22 Dylan Dunn-BEVERLY HILLS, FL
10-20K Nick Kirkus-Yulee, FL
11-24 Dakota Nichols-Tifton, GA
12-15 Bron Rutledge-Centre, AL
13-12C Chase Giddens-Moultrie, GA
14-1 Hania Humphries-St. Augustine, FL
15-515 Bubba Roling-Clay Hill, FL
16-11R Ryan Beckelheimer-High Springs, FL
17-18 David Showers Sr-St. Augustine, FL
18-53 Brandon Yates-Ruskin, FL
19-01 Fletcher Mason-Raiford, FL
20-11 Quentin Steedley-High Springs, FL
21-71 Davy Cline-St. Augustine, FL
22-10X Dave Ponton-Lake City, FL
23-5B Brenton Koontz-Ft. White, FL
24-25 Charley Cowart-Columbus, GA
DNS-31 Dustin Beckelheimer-High Springs, FL
DQ-45 Jason Garver-Starke, FL
Car Count: 26

Lap Leaders:
Bubba Roling – 16 laps
Jason Garver – 3 laps

Hard Charger:
Brody Smith (+12) – 21st to 9th
